Yes, though a record may be maintained of all meds taken and their indications; it may be that the medical condition necessitating the use of the meds may create more of a barrier to entrance than the meds themselves. They will want to know if the medical conditions create a disability to perform anticipated military duties, or if use of the meds may affect your abilities to serve in the military. It is worth noting that the military may have relaxed their entry requirements in recent years and allow more waivers than in the past.

Can someone who takes daily medicine for hypothyroidism join the military?

Yes, as long as you provide your recruiter with TSH lab results and a clearance letter from that doctor documenting the medication you are currently on and that you would be clear for military training
